Output e15a589a17bdc1b9bf0e6af88fed6e9e27d079f89bc05208c8f9b23f25510b17: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227d004fe28f987513148c093b05bbd258542c6d OP_EQUAL
address
34qNeJXMUrKwmk48GrEmqHqdoRogSAwjN3
transaction
e15a589a17bdc1b9bf0e6af88fed6e9e27d079f89bc05208c8f9b23f25510b17
confirmations
506876
spent
true